Goodbye
I must say goodbye to my addiction
And goodbye to the violence
In my heart.
Saying farewell to my
Former self.
It may be difficult,
At times,
But it's just the start
To a new journey
Of the heart.
Where pain no longer taints
The pattern of my life's quilt.
There comes a time for acceptance.
To accept joy into my heart,
As it bursts through
The icy walls
That are surrounded by doubt.
I must stop,
I must dive head first into recovery,
To say hello to
A new version of me.
